Angela Wilson Obituary

Angela Wilson

Sep 8, 1961 - Jul 1, 2024

Sandusky

Angela (Thomas) Wilson, 62, of Sandusky, entered her heavenly home unexpectedly Monday, July 1, 2024, at her home.

She was born Sept. 8, 1961, in Columbus, Mississippi, to Travis Thomas Sr. and Ruth D. Nash.

Angela came to Sandusky in 1964 and graduated from Sandusky High School. She was employed at Wendy's, Providence Hospital, Erie County Care Facility, and Ohio Veterans Home for about 20 years before she retired. In her spare time, she enjoyed taking care of her grandchildren and spending time with her dog, Melli. Angela loved watching classic westerns and Sanford & Son.

Angela attended The Assembly Jesus Christ Church and Emmanuel Temple Pentecostal Church.

Angela is survived by her sons, Bryant Thomas and Anthony (Erica Pennix) Wilson, both of Sandusky; mother, Ruth D. (Nash) Thomas of Sandusky; mother-in-law, Lillie Mae Wilson of Sandusky; three brothers, Douglas E. Thomas of Milan, Travis Thomas Jr. of Florida, and Craig (Marla) Thomas of Monroeville; sister, Amy Thomas of Sandusky; five granddaughters; five grandsons; and numerous nieces, nephews, and other relatives.

She was preceded in death by her husband, Melvin Wilson in 2018; father, Travis Thomas Sr.; father-in-law, Hershel Wilson; stepfather, Paul Aviles; grandmother, Amanda Gray White; and two brothers, Donald and Gary Thomas.

Visitation for friends will be 11 a.m. Wednesday, July 10, 2024, until the time of Angela's funeral at 12 p.m. at Emmanuel Temple Church, 128 E. Adams St., Sandusky. Burial will follow at Meadow Green Memorial Park.

Toft Funeral Home & Crematory, 2001 Columbus Ave., Sandusky, is handling arrangements.
